Propyltrimethoxysilane is an organosilicon compound used as an intermediate in the production of silane coupling agents. It is also listed as an inert ingredient permitted for use in non-food pesticide products.

The international HS code for Propyltrimethoxysilane (CAS 1067-25-0) is 2931.90.
2931.90
2931 90 00
Classification per the EU customs inventory ECICS (2026-07 snapshot, HS 2022). National tariff lines and product form can affect the final classification.
